[corrigé] Problème avec les coordonnées suisses
-
- Messages : 273
- Enregistré le : 13 avr. 2010, 21:41
- Localisation : Alpes vaudoises
[corrigé] Problème avec les coordonnées suisses
Je constate qu'un problème réapparait périodiquement : au moment où l'on choisit d'introduire les coordonnées suisses pour ajouter un nouveau point, il suffit que l'on introduise la première coordonnée et que l'on clique sur un autre site pour que tout s'efface et que l'on soit soumis au choix restreint de 5 systèmes de coordonnées autres que le suisse. Très agaçant ...
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
Certains types de coordonnées ne sont définis que dans une zone donnée (les coordonnées suissgrid par exemple ne prennent pas de valeur négative).
La liste de choix des coordonnées est donc restreinte à celles définies à la position courante du curseur (sinon, l'affichage devient incohérent).
J'ai aussi introduit ce filtre pour éviter d'avoir une liste de choix trop longue.
Il faut replacer le curseur à l'intérieur du domaine de définition du type de coordonnée désiré (en Suisse par exemple) pour avoir de nouveau ce choix.
La liste de choix des coordonnées est donc restreinte à celles définies à la position courante du curseur (sinon, l'affichage devient incohérent).
J'ai aussi introduit ce filtre pour éviter d'avoir une liste de choix trop longue.
Il faut replacer le curseur à l'intérieur du domaine de définition du type de coordonnée désiré (en Suisse par exemple) pour avoir de nouveau ce choix.
Dominique http://chemineur.fr
-
- Messages : 273
- Enregistré le : 13 avr. 2010, 21:41
- Localisation : Alpes vaudoises
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
J'ai inhibé la révision de la liste de coordonnées sur saisie des champs
Dis moi si ça résout ton problème
Dis moi si ça résout ton problème
Dominique http://chemineur.fr
-
- Messages : 273
- Enregistré le : 13 avr. 2010, 21:41
- Localisation : Alpes vaudoises
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
Grand dieux ! Je ne comprend pas
1/ Peux tu vider tes caches ? (touche fonction F5). Suivant les explorateurs, ça peut être nécessaire pour recharger la librairie contenant la modif
2/ Quel explorateur utilises tu ?
3/ Je fais la séquence suivante: (sur FF / IE11 / Chrome / Opera / Safari)
- "Ajouter un point"
- "Passer à l'étape suivante"
- Changement du système de coordonnées en SwissGrid
- Click sur le champ longitude
- Saisie de la longitude
- Click sur le champ latitude
- Saisie de la latitude
1/ Peux tu vider tes caches ? (touche fonction F5). Suivant les explorateurs, ça peut être nécessaire pour recharger la librairie contenant la modif
2/ Quel explorateur utilises tu ?
3/ Je fais la séquence suivante: (sur FF / IE11 / Chrome / Opera / Safari)
- "Ajouter un point"
- "Passer à l'étape suivante"
- Changement du système de coordonnées en SwissGrid
- Click sur le champ longitude
- Saisie de la longitude
- Click sur le champ latitude
- Saisie de la latitude
Dominique http://chemineur.fr
-
- Messages : 273
- Enregistré le : 13 avr. 2010, 21:41
- Localisation : Alpes vaudoises
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
Bizarre. Je ne dois pas faire la même séquence
- "Ajouter un point"
- "Passer à l'étape suivante"
- Changement du système de coordonnées en SwissGrid
- Click sur le champ longitude
- Saisie de la longitude
- Click sur le champ latitude
- Saisie de la latitude
Peux tu décrire ta séquence exacte ?
- "Ajouter un point"
- "Passer à l'étape suivante"
- Changement du système de coordonnées en SwissGrid
- Click sur le champ longitude
- Saisie de la longitude
- Click sur le champ latitude
- Saisie de la latitude
Peux tu décrire ta séquence exacte ?
Dominique http://chemineur.fr
-
- Messages : 5041
- Enregistré le : 29 févr. 2004, 17:59
- Localisation : Chambéry - Savoie
ici firefox 17 et tout marche sans faire F5 ou reload ou autre.
Je peux même basculer d'une projection à l'autre et la conversion est faite automatiquement
Seule amélioration "luxe" que l'on pourrait envisager, c'est que le texte d'ambiance :
"Degrés décimaux WGS84 ex: 45.2356 et -5.2354" ne soit pas figé mais change selon la projection choisie.
Mais bon, sur refuges.info, on est pas la pour le luxe en général ;-)
Je peux même basculer d'une projection à l'autre et la conversion est faite automatiquement
Seule amélioration "luxe" que l'on pourrait envisager, c'est que le texte d'ambiance :
"Degrés décimaux WGS84 ex: 45.2356 et -5.2354" ne soit pas figé mais change selon la projection choisie.
Mais bon, sur refuges.info, on est pas la pour le luxe en général ;-)
-
- Messages : 273
- Enregistré le : 13 avr. 2010, 21:41
- Localisation : Alpes vaudoises
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
Tudieu ! Je ne l'avais pas vu celui làsly a écrit :Seule amélioration "luxe" que l'on pourrait envisager, c'est que le texte d'ambiance :
"Degrés décimaux WGS84 ex: 45.2356 et -5.2354" ne soit pas figé mais change selon la projection choisie.
Ha! ben, c'est déjà assez compliqué comme ça...
Dominique http://chemineur.fr
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
C'est le " clique sur un autre site" que j'ai du mal à comprendreSwisstrekker a écrit :C'est ok tant que l'on ne clique pas sur un autre site après avoir introduit les coordonnées x (par exemple pour contrôler la coordonnée y). Sinon la coordonnée suisse disparaît et l'on doit recommencer l'opération à zéro ...
Quand on est en édition sur une page, en principe, on ne va pas se balader sur d'autres sites sur le même onglet ?
Je suis d'accord, sur un formulaire standard, ça marche. Mais ce formulaire est un peu spécial: ses champs sont réinitialisés par le javascript quand on charge ou recharge. ça va être un peu difficile de restituer où on en est au retour.
Suggestion: si les touches "contrôle" et "majuscule" (shift) sont enfoncées quand tu cliques sur un autre site (une icône ?), ce site s'ouvrira dans un onglet différent et tu pourras revenir à ton onglet de saisie parfaitement sauvegardé
Dominique http://chemineur.fr
-
- Messages : 273
- Enregistré le : 13 avr. 2010, 21:41
- Localisation : Alpes vaudoises
J'ai mes deux onglets en simultané. Pour simplifier, disons que j'ai trouvé les coordonnées sur un site A, je veux ajouter le point sur Refuges.info, je suis la démarche habituelle, veux introduire les coordonnées suisses, j'introduis la première coordonnée, clique sur le site A pour vérifier la seconde coordonnée et au moment où je reclique sur Refuges.info, les coordonnées suisses ont disparu. Est-ce que c'est un peu plus limpide pour toi, expliqué ainsi ?
-
- Messages : 3704
- Enregistré le : 08 avr. 2006, 21:58
ça parait très clair mais, chez moi, ça fonctionne:
Sur Mozilla 26.0 (sur PC Win7)
Je vais sur http://www.jo-sac.ch/pierre-pertuis/cabane.htm
J'ouvre un nouvel onglet
Sur cet onglet, je vais sur http://refuges.info
"Ajouter un point"
"Passer à l'étape suivante"
Changement du système de coordonnées en SwissGrid
Je reviens sur le premier onglet
Je sélectionne la longitude 583260
Copier
Je reviens sur l'onglet WRI
Click sur le champ longitude
Sélection de tout le champ
Coller
Je reviens sur le premier onglet
Je sélectionne la latitude 228633
Copier
Je reviens sur l'onglet WRI
Click sur le champ latitude
Sélection de tout le champ
Coller
Et je n'ai rien perdu
Procèdes tu différemment ?
Sur un MAC ?
Sur Mozilla 26.0 (sur PC Win7)
Je vais sur http://www.jo-sac.ch/pierre-pertuis/cabane.htm
J'ouvre un nouvel onglet
Sur cet onglet, je vais sur http://refuges.info
"Ajouter un point"
"Passer à l'étape suivante"
Changement du système de coordonnées en SwissGrid
Je reviens sur le premier onglet
Je sélectionne la longitude 583260
Copier
Je reviens sur l'onglet WRI
Click sur le champ longitude
Sélection de tout le champ
Coller
Je reviens sur le premier onglet
Je sélectionne la latitude 228633
Copier
Je reviens sur l'onglet WRI
Click sur le champ latitude
Sélection de tout le champ
Coller
Et je n'ai rien perdu
Procèdes tu différemment ?
Sur un MAC ?
Dominique http://chemineur.fr
-
- Messages : 5041
- Enregistré le : 29 févr. 2004, 17:59
- Localisation : Chambéry - Savoie
Pareil que dominique, je n'ai pas trop compris la séquence, mais j'ai l'impression de me rapprocher avec la séquence suivante :
1) http://www.refuges.info/point_ajout
2) peut importe le choix
3) étape suivante
4) passage en coordonnées suisse
5) mettre un valeur pour x comme par exemple 1000
6) mettre la valeur vide : "" (ou tout sauf un nombre) pour y
6) changer le focus vers n'importe où
7) les champs x et y se replissent avec la chaîne "NaN NaN"
8) plus possible de s'en dépêtrer pour faire une saisie correcte. la valeur saisie "1000" a été perdue, et si on y retourne pour mettre 1000 tout changement de focus replace "NaN" qui est toujours "Not a Number" pour y
Avec les autres projections, le NaN se rempli aussi, mais juste dans le champ pour lequel c'est vrai
1) http://www.refuges.info/point_ajout
2) peut importe le choix
3) étape suivante
4) passage en coordonnées suisse
5) mettre un valeur pour x comme par exemple 1000
6) mettre la valeur vide : "" (ou tout sauf un nombre) pour y
6) changer le focus vers n'importe où
7) les champs x et y se replissent avec la chaîne "NaN NaN"
8) plus possible de s'en dépêtrer pour faire une saisie correcte. la valeur saisie "1000" a été perdue, et si on y retourne pour mettre 1000 tout changement de focus replace "NaN" qui est toujours "Not a Number" pour y
Avec les autres projections, le NaN se rempli aussi, mais juste dans le champ pour lequel c'est vrai